The Scientific Revolution encouraged a focus on empirical observation, experimentation, and the systematic use of reason to understand the natural world. It emphasized the importance of questioning traditional beliefs and seeking knowledge through direct evidence and mathematical reasoning. This movement laid the groundwork for modern science by promoting the idea that human inquiry and rational thought could lead to advancements in understanding the universe. Ultimately, it shifted the paradigm from reliance on religious and philosophical explanations to a more scientific and evidence-based approach.

The Scientific Revolution encouraged people to question and critically evaluate the assertions of authority figures, particularly in areas such as science, religion, and philosophy. It fostered a spirit of skepticism and inquiry, leading individuals to seek evidence and rational explanations rather than blindly accepting traditional doctrines. This shift laid the groundwork for modern scientific thinking and democratic ideals, emphasizing the importance of reason and empirical evidence over mere tradition or dogma.

Enlightenment thinkers were influenced by the scientific revolution as it demonstrated the power of reason, observation, and the scientific method in uncovering truths about the natural world. This inspired them to apply similar principles to human society and governance, leading to a focus on individual rights, reason, and progress. The scientific revolution laid the foundation for Enlightenment ideas of rationality, empiricism, and the belief in progress through human reason and knowledge.
